Budongo forest reserve is one of the best places to track Chimpanzees in Uganda. Tracking is done either in the morning or the afternoon based on preference and availability of Chimpanzee permits. This tour typically starts after a winding drive to the beautiful forest, followed by a briefing from your designated park ranger. The trek may take anywhere from 30 minutes to over an hour, depending on the Chimps' location that day.
Once a troop is found, you’ll spend up to one hour observing these primates, which share 98% of our DNA. You'll witness incredible behavior such as grooming, foraging, vocalizing, feeding, playing, and swinging through the canopy with remarkable agility—an awe-inspiring experience that’s both intimate and wild. You shall also be exposed to other primates, plants, and shrubs of this vast forest.

Masindi is a charming town in Uganda known for its proximity to Murchison Falls National Park, one of the country's most stunning wildlife reserves. The town offers a blend of natural beauty, cultural experiences, and historical significance, making it an appealing destination for adventure seekers and nature lovers.
